about the cover illustration

 

The image featured on the cover of this book is called “Mařaťanka” by Joža Uprka (1861–1940), a Czech painter renowned for his vivid portrayals of folk life in southern Moravia, a historic wine-growing region in the Czech Republic. The painting depicts a young woman from the village of Mařatice, whose name echoes the ancient designation “sons of Maria” for its inhabitants. Dressed in a traditional local costume, she carries a tray of grapes and fruit aloft, embodying the spirit of harvest, abundance, and the enduring rhythm of historical rural life. It is a celebration of shared European traditions rooted in the land, the seasons, and community rituals. Like wine itself, these themes transcend borders and bring people together, mirroring the Czecho-Italian nature of the co-authoring team.
